What will happen if Vin goes below or equal to the target Vout?
for example: below is our design. if Vin goes down to 15V or lower than 15V, what will LM5164 behave ?

A controllable on-time as low as 50 ns permits high step-down ratios and a minimum forced off-time of 50 ns provides extremely high duty cycles allowing VIN to drop close to VOUT before frequency foldback occurs.
Tonmax=10000ns.
Dmax= Tonmax/(Tonmax+Toffmin)
When VOUT will keep regulated until VIN is equal to VOUT/Dmax.
Then VOUT will decrease with VIN.
